Phenolic Foam:

Phenolic foam is highly regarded for its exceptional fire resistance, making it a preferred choice in applications where fire safety is a primary concern, such as in building and construction insulation. The thermal stability and low smoke generation of phenolic foam further enhance its suitability for use in high-risk environments. As regulatory frameworks become increasingly stringent, industries are turning to phenolic foam to fulfill their fire safety requirements. The robustness and longevity of phenolic foam also contribute to its growing market appeal, as it offers durability alongside fire protection. The demand for phenolic foam is anticipated to rise significantly, particularly as energy efficiency and safety continue to be prioritized across industries.

By Ingredient Type

Alumina Trihydrate:

Alumina trihydrate is a widely used ingredient in flame retardant foams due to its effectiveness in providing fire resistance. This mineral compound functions as a flame retardant by releasing water vapor when exposed to heat, thereby cools the foam and reduces the intensity of flames. Its non-toxic nature and excellent thermal properties make it suitable for various applications, particularly in building and construction materials. As safety regulations become more stringent, the demand for flame retardant foams containing alumina trihydrate is expected to increase. Moreover, the growing preference for environmentally friendly materials is driving the incorporation of this ingredient, as it aligns with sustainability goals in many industries.

Brominated Flame Retardants:

Brominated flame retardants are another significant category of ingredients used in flame retardant foams, known for their high efficiency in preventing combustion. These compounds are particularly effective in low-density foams, making them ideal for applications in electronics and automotive sectors. While brominated flame retardants offer excellent performance, regulatory scrutiny surrounding their environmental impact has led to the development of alternative formulations. Nevertheless, demand for brominated flame retardants in flame retardant foams remains robust, particularly in applications where fire safety is of paramount importance. As manufacturers navigate regulatory landscapes, innovations in brominated flame retardant technologies will play a critical role in shaping market dynamics.

Chlorinated Flame Retardants:

Chlorinated flame retardants are recognized for their effectiveness and versatility in enhancing the fire resistance of various foam types. These compounds are widely utilized in applications such as upholstery, insulation, and automotive interiors, where fire safety is a critical requirement. The ability of chlorinated flame retardants to form a protective char layer during combustion significantly reduces the spread of flames. However, similar to brominated counterparts, chlorinated flame retardants face increasing regulatory pressures due to environmental and health concerns. Manufacturers are investing in research to develop safer alternatives and improve the performance of chlorinated flame retardants, ensuring their continued relevance within the flame retardant foam market.

Phosphorus Flame Retardants:

Phosphorus flame retardants are gaining traction in the flame retardant foam market due to their effectiveness and growing acceptance as a safer alternative to halogenated flame retardants. These compounds work by promoting char formation during combustion, thereby inhibiting flame spread and reducing smoke generation. The increasing awareness of environmental and health impacts associated with traditional flame retardants is driving the adoption of phosphorus-based formulations across various applications, including electronics, automotive, and building materials. As regulatory pressures continue to evolve, the demand for phosphorus flame retardants in flame retardant foam applications is expected to rise, further shaping the market landscape.

Antimony Trioxide:

Antimony trioxide is a commonly used synergist in flame retardant formulations, enhancing the effectiveness of halogenated flame retardants in foam applications. This compound functions by promoting the formation of an insulating char layer during combustion, which acts as a barrier to flame spread. Antimony trioxide is often used in combination with other flame retardants to achieve improved fire safety performance. However, as the market shifts towards more environmentally friendly solutions, there is growing scrutiny over the use of antimony trioxide due to potential health and environmental concerns. Consequently, manufacturers are exploring alternative synergists and flame retardant formulations, which may influence the future dynamics of this ingredient within the flame retardant foam market.

By Region

The flame retardant foam market is experiencing variances in growth across different regions, with North America leading in market share due to stringent fire safety regulations and a robust construction industry. In 2022, North America accounted for approximately 35% of the global flame retardant foam market, driven by the increasing demand for fire-resistant materials across various sectors. The automotive industry in the U.S. has seen significant advancements in safety regulations, resulting in a higher adoption of flame retardant foams in vehicle interiors. Additionally, the ongoing urbanization and infrastructure development projects are expected to further boost market growth in the region. With a projected CAGR of 5.8%, North America is anticipated to maintain its dominance throughout the forecast period.

In Europe, the market for flame retardant foam is expected to witness substantial growth as well, primarily propelled by stringent regulations regarding fire safety and environmental impacts. The region accounted for approximately 30% of the global market share in 2022, with increasing investments in building and construction projects promoting the use of flame retardant materials. The European Union's focus on sustainability and the circular economy is prompting manufacturers to innovate more eco-friendly flame retardant solutions, thus expanding market opportunities. Meanwhile, the Asia Pacific region is also emerging as a significant market, with a growing demand for flame retardant foams in construction, automotive, and electronics sectors, contributing to the overall global market dynamics.
